Filing 51 ORDER ADOPTING 41 REPORT AND RECOMMENDATIONS OF THE UNITED STATES MAGISTRATE JUDGE. Plaintiff's Objections are OVERRULED. The Court further ADOPTS the Magistrate Judge's Report and Recommendation in its entirety as the findings of this Co urt. The Defendants' motions to dismiss under Rule 12(b)(6) and on the basis of res judicata (Docket Nos. 6 , 15 , and 33 ) are GRANTED, and all of Plaintiff's claims against all Defendants are DISMISSED WITH PREJUDICE. Furthermore, Pl aintiff shall seek leave of the Court before filing any lawsuit pertaining to the subject of Property against the Bayview Defendants in the federal courts of Texas. It is further ORDERED that any and all motions not previously ruled on are DENIED. Signed by Judge Robert W. Schroeder, III on 9/27/2017. (rlf) |
